DISCOVER THE EXTENSIVE INTERNET PROVIDERS MANUAL FOR A COMPREHENSIVE INTRO TO INTERACTION PROTOCOLS-YOUR TRICK TO UNLOCKING THE WORLD OF WEB SOLUTIONS

Discover The Extensive Internet Providers Manual For A Comprehensive Intro To Interaction Protocols-Your Trick To Unlocking The World Of Web Solutions

Discover The Extensive Internet Providers Manual For A Comprehensive Intro To Interaction Protocols-Your Trick To Unlocking The World Of Web Solutions

Blog Article

Composed By-Pihl Cramer

Discover the best Web Services Handbook for all your needs. Explore interaction procedures, core ideas of SOAP and remainder, and finest practices for smooth application. Discover the keys to mastering web services, from recognizing the fundamentals to executing scalable architecture. Master the art of creating secure systems and enhancing for future development. Unlock the power of web solutions at your fingertips.

Summary of Web Services



If you've ever questioned what internet solutions are and how they function, this summary is the excellent location to start. Web services are a means for various applications to interact with each other over the internet. seo content websites allow for seamless combination of systems, making it much easier to share data and capabilities.

Among the vital facets of internet services is their use conventional methods like HTTP and XML to assist in interaction. This standardization makes sure that different systems can understand and communicate with each other successfully. Internet solutions can be classified into two main types: SOAP (Simple Things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while REST relies upon common HTTP techniques like GET, POST, PUT, and DELETE. Both have their strengths and are used in various circumstances based on requirements.

Key Ideas and Technologies



Exploring the foundational concepts and modern technologies of internet solutions is essential for comprehending their functionality and application in modern systems. When diving right into the crucial concepts and technologies of web services, you unlock to a world of interconnected possibilities. Right here are some essential elements to realize:

- ** SOAP (Simple Things Gain Access To Method) **: This procedure defines the framework of messages exchanged between web solutions.
- ** WSDL (Internet Services Description Language) **: WSDL is used to describe the capabilities provided by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that uses common HTTP approaches for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ential duty in data exchange between web services due to its flexibility and readability.

Understanding these core concepts and innovations will lay a solid foundation for your trip right into the world of internet services.

Best Practices for Application



To guarantee successful implementation of internet solutions, focus on adherence to ideal methods. Begin by thoroughly documenting your internet solution APIs, consisting of clear descriptions of endpoints, specifications, and anticipated actions. Regular calling conventions and versioning of APIs are vital for maintainability. When designing your web services, follow the principles of REST to produce a scalable and adaptable architecture. Implement appropriate authentication and authorization systems to secure your solutions, such as OAuth or API keys.

https://www.dailyhawker.com/business/growing-your-cannabis-business-7-seo-tips/ is crucial in making sure the dependability of your internet services. Create thorough test cases that cover various circumstances, consisting of favorable and adverse testing. Constant combination and automated testing can assist capture issues early in the advancement procedure. Display your web solutions in real-time to determine efficiency bottlenecks and potential failures. Logging and mistake handling are vital for diagnosing problems and troubleshooting troubles effectively.



Last but not least, take into consideration the scalability of your internet services by designing for future development. Apply caching mechanisms and load balancing to handle boosted web traffic. Routinely review and maximize your code for efficiency. By following https://videomarketingyoutube39406.bloggactif.com/27094366/5-ways-to-optimize-site-loading-speed-for-better-individual-experience , you can enhance the application of internet solutions and ensure their success.

Verdict

Congratulations! You've just opened the secret to grasping web services. By recognizing the vital concepts and modern technologies, and applying finest methods, you're well on your method to becoming an internet solutions professional.

Keep exploring and experimenting with what you have actually found out to proceed expanding your understanding and skills in this interesting field.

mobile website development of internet services is currently within your reaches, ready for you to check out and conquer. Take pleasure in the journey!